    IBM Watson Language Translator (discontinued)

    Score8 out of 10
    N/AIBM Watson Language Translator allowed users of IBM Watson to translate news stories and documents from one language to another with neural machine translation. The product is EOL from June 2023, after which it will no longer be for sale, or supported.N/A

    Weglot

    Score5 out of 10
    N/AWeglot is a translation tool from the company of the same name in Paris, that aims to enable users to make a website multilingual in minutes and to manage all translations.

    Weglot
    Weglot is great for a small static website that doesn't have frequent content updates. It is also good for businesses that want to look at only a single language translation. It tends to fall apart when you either have a larger, growing website or multiple languages that you want to translate for. We had the system cut out several times when we first launched due to it repeatedly hitting our translation cap, with little or no warning from the vendor. Once it happened during a critical communication time.

    Weglot
    • Price model is very poor for larger websites who produce content regularly
    • Price model is also poor for multiple language options (ie, each language translation is a separate cost)
    • Customer service isn't very helpful (non-US based company)
